Atmospheric nanoparticles (PM0.1), defined as particles with spherical equivalent diameters smaller than 100 nm, has been found having adverse health effects to the public (Furuuchi et al.,2010). Moreover, the ratio of two main components in elemental carbon (EC): char-EC and soot-EC can be thought as an effective indicator for source identification (Han, 2010). This study aims to assess featured annual and seasonal characteristics of nanoparticle pollution compared with total suspended particle (TSP) in Kanazawa, Japan.
